Council Minutes of 1/15/2008 <br />Councilmen Barker and Orlowski; Law Director, Service Director and City Engineer. <br />The committee discussed Resolution 2008-3, sponsored by Councilman Gareau, a <br />resolution urging the Cuyahoga County Engineer and the Director of the Ohio <br />Department of Transportation to inspect Lorain Road, State Route 10, from Canterbury <br />Road to the city's east corporation line in order to determine whether the 2006 <br />resurfacing of Lorain Road, which is badly cracking, by a State of Ohio contractor was <br />performed in accordance with the ODOT bid specifications and all other ODOT roadway <br />and other requirements and standards; and declaring an emergency. The Service Director <br />and City Engineer were working with our Law Director to come to a determination if this <br />project was not completed properly. The administration told the committee that they <br />would report back as to their findings. The committee unanimously voted to hold the <br />legislation in committee pending more information from the administration. The meeting <br />ended at 8:11 p.m. An update on the legislation will be given to the committee on <br />Tuesday, January 29, at 6:45 p.m. Also at that time, the committee will be presented with <br />the 2007 street survey and an update on the Stearns Road construction. <br />Councilman Kearney, chairperson of the Public Safety, Health & Welfare Committee: 1) <br />The committee met at 8:15 p.m. on Tuesday, January 8. Present were committee <br />members Orlowski, Mahoney and Kearney; President Kennedy and Council Members <br />Barker and Jones; Law Director Dubelko and Safety Director Thomas. Agenda items: <br />• Ordinance 2007-72, the "Do Not Knock Registry," was discussed. Mr. Dubelko <br />explained amendments to the ordinance, and the pros and cons were discussed. <br />The committee unanimously recommended approval to Council. <br />• A liquor license transfer at 2S78S Lorain Road, Smokey Bones Barbecue. <br />Ownership of the restaurant is being transferred from GMRI to Barbecue <br />Integrated Inc. The Police Dept. noted that the restaurant had caused no trouble in <br />the past. The transfer was recommended by committee 3-0. Councilman Kearney <br />moved that Council have no objection to the liquor transfer at Smokey Bones <br />Barbecue. The motion was seconded by Councilman Orlowski and passed <br />unanimously. <br />• As recommended by the Law Director, Councilman Kearney made a motion to <br />amend 2007-72 in accordance with the committee's recommendations and the <br />additional recommendations that came out of IT, all as set forth in the <br />revised amended drafted ordinance that Council had received. The motion was <br />seconded by Councilman Gareau and passed unanimously. <br />Councilman Mahoney, chairperson of the Recreation, Public Parks & Buildings <br />Committee: 1) The committee met this evening, January 1 S, 2008, at 7 p.m. Present <br />were chairman Mahoney and committee member Jones; President Kennedy, Councilmen <br />Gareau, Kearney, Barker and Orlowski; the Mayor, Community Life Services Director; <br />Planning Director; guests.
